RetroArch is not just an N64 emulator; it is the "Swiss Army Knife" of emulation. It uses "cores" (plugins). For N64, you will use the Mupen64Plus-Next core or ParaLLEl core.

However, a word of caution: N64 emulation is trickier than emulating older consoles like the SNES or Genesis. The N64’s unique architecture (with its Reality Coprocessor) requires more CPU power. While a $300 Chromebook will handle Mario Kart 64 easily, a high-end gaming Chromebook is required for perfect GoldenEye or Conker’s Bad Fur Day .
